当前位置: X-MOL 学术IEEE Netw. › 论文详情
Our official English website, www.x-mol.net, welcomes your feedback! (Note: you will need to create a separate account there.)
Toward Blockchain-Powered Trusted Collaborative Services for Edge-Centric Networks
IEEE NETWORK ( IF 9.3 ) Pub Date : 2020-04-02 , DOI: 10.1109/mnet.001.1900153
Bo Wu , Ke Xu , Qi Li , Shoushou Ren , Zhuotao Liu , Zhichao Zhang

Collaborative edge computing (CEC) is a novel extension for several edge paradigms (e.g., mobile edge computing, fog computing, and cloudlet) to further enhance processing capabilities to support computation-intensive and latency-sensitive applications in edge-centric networks. While existing schemes keep adding new functionalities (e.g., collaborative computing and caching), they overlook an important issue of establishing trustworthiness among all CEC participants. In general, due to the heterogeneity of all participants, simply assuming trustworthiness among them is undesirable. To address this issue, in this article, we present BlockEdge, a blockchain-powered framework that delivers trusted CEC services. Toward this end, BlockEdge first introduces incentive schemes to attract edge nodes to participate in CEC tasks. Then it publicly and persistently stores all task results on blockchain to enable smart-contract-based correctness verification and automated punishment in case of failures. Such a built-in accountability scheme allows BlockEdge to establish a trust reputation system for all CEC stakeholders, which can be further used for reliable selection of CEC participators. Our security analysis and experimental evaluation demonstrate that BlockEdge is both technically feasible and financially beneficial. We hope that the blockchain-based trustworthiness establishment designed in BlockEdge can provide a fundamental primitive for building a more secure collaborative ecosystem, especially for complex networks such as 5G and IoT.

中文翻译:

面向以边缘为中心的网络的区块链支持的可信协作服务

协作边缘计算(CEC)是对几种边缘范例(例如,移动边缘计算,雾计算和cloudlet)的新颖扩展,以进一步增强处理能力,以支持边缘中心网络中计算密集型和延迟敏感的应用程序。尽管现有的方案不断增加新的功能(例如,协作计算和缓存),但它们却忽略了在所有CEC参与者之间建立可信度的重要问题。通常,由于所有参与者的异质性,仅假设他们之间的可信度是不可取的。为了解决这个问题,在本文中,我们介绍了BlockEdge,这是一种由区块链支持的框架,可提供可信的CEC服务。为此,BlockEdge首先引入了激励机制,以吸引边缘节点参与CEC任务。然后,它将所有任务结果公开并持久地存储在区块链上,以实现基于智能合约的正确性验证,并在出现故障时自动进行惩罚。这种内置的问责机制允许BlockEdge为所有CEC利益相关者建立信任信誉系统,该系统可进一步用于可靠地选择CEC参与者。我们的安全性分析和实验评估表明,BlockEdge在技术上既可行又在经济上有利。我们希望,在BlockEdge中设计的基于区块链的可信赖性机构可以为构建更安全的协作生态系统提供基本基础,特别是对于5G和IoT等复杂网络而言。
更新日期:2020-04-22
down
wechat
bug